Best definition
yet another booby babe

Tom : I think I like Alice, she is so intelligent and cool.

Bob: I dont think so, she is just a yabb imo.
yabb: define #2
To get fucked up, whether it be alcohol, weed or narcs.
Yo proe you tryna yabb tonight?

Fuckyea dude let’s get yabbed out!